Dharti Se Sitaron Tak (Earth to Centauri): Alien Hunt (Hindi Edition) Kindle Edition
अपने स्पेसशिप ‘अंतरिक्ष’ के साथ कैप्टन अनारा और उनका क्रू धरती की ओर वापस लौट चले हैं. पर उनके पीछे किफरविस़ ग्रह पर गृह-युद्ध छिड़ गया है. एक गुप्त संदेश से अनारा को धरती पर दुश्मनों के जासूसों के भेजे जाने की चेतावनी मिलती है. उनके मिशन के बारे में तो उसे कुछ नहीं पता, लेकिन वह इतना ज़रूर जानती है कि उनके इरादे नेक नहीं हैं. तारों के बीच होने वाले इतिहास के पहले युद्ध को रोकने के लिए उसके पास सिर्फ कुछ दिनों का समय है – एक ऐसा युद्ध, जो धरती पर मनुष्य की कल्पना से कहीं बढ़कर तबाही ला सकता है.
अब शुरू होती है – अनारा के क्रू और ‘नेशनल इन्वेस्टीगेशन एजेंसी’ (NIA) द्वारा मुम्बई मेगासिटी की गलियों में आज तक की सबसे बड़ी खोज. दुश्मन के षड्यंत्र का पता लगाने के लिए समय के साथ दौड़ लगाते हुए उन्हें एक देशद्रोही का पता चलता है. और इसके साथ ही संदेह के घेरे में आ जाती है - खुद अनारा. 3 करोड़ से भी ज़्यादा लोगों के साथ-साथ एक अनोखी, मासूम जिंदगी की सुरक्षा का भार भी अब अनारा के कंधों पर है.
धरती के संभावित वास्तविक भविष्य की कल्पना पर बुने गए ताने-बाने पर आधारित यह टेक्नो-थ्रिलर नॉवल आपको रहस्य और रोमांच की रोंगटे खड़े कर देने वाली एक ऐसी दुनिया में ले जाता है, जो जल्द ही हकीकत में बदलने का दम रखती है.

About the author

Whether you want to discuss faster-than-light travel, time travel, black holes or just the latest mobile phone, Kumar is your person.
He is a tech and social media enthusiast. He enjoys travelling and is fluent in several languages. A mechanical engineer who loves pulling apart gadgets and exploring their innards, he writes science fiction stories and tries to bring future technology alive in his books.
The First Journey is the first book of the Earth to Centauri series. It is easy to read and understand and is suitable for all age groups. The First Journey and Alien Hunt, the second book in the series, are both based on themes of adventure, thrill and drama, with a positive outlook at what the future may hold for humanity. Black Hole: Oblivion is the third book in the series with the latest adventure of Captain Anara and her crew.
A set of Sci-Fi stories was recently released – Deceptions of Tomorrow: Electrifying tales of Robots, Black Holes & Time Travel. He has also written a collection of stories - 8 Down from Saharanpur.

4.0 out of 5 stars Get yourself introduced to a new experience with new genre.
Dharti Se Sitaron Tak (Earth to Centauri): Alien Hunt is second part of the series by Kumar L.
The first part in itself made me so curious to read the second part and this part is also above the expectations which increased my interest in science fictions.
The story starts with the 22nd century where captain Anara is shown as the protagonist with a huge responsibility and how she manages to handle everything with NIA.
So this is not just a science fiction but a techno-thriller, almost a new genre which is way more gripping then the previous part, reading it in hindi was amazing as well.
The storyline is very smooth and also the narration, and research done by the author is commendable.
Overall this is must read book to get yourself introduced to a whole new experience, and it will make you curious to read the next part as well.

4.0 out of 5 stars Intriguing
Well, Alien hunt is the part two of the trilogy Earth to Centauri. After reading this I got to learn a lot about stars, meteors, asteroids, and other astronomical entities. The book is set in year 2095 and revolves around a captain- CAPTAIN ANARA who managed to use voyager I which was discovered in 1977 and somehow the astronomer reached Proxima, the nearest star. Description of artificial intelligence in layman language is the the most intriguing part of this book. If you are a physics student you cannot miss this out! Seems author knows a lot about AI and is bestowed with a great sight. Language used is simple, Cover is attractive and story is fast faced as well.
